Kathmandu airport reopens today, 24 hours after it was closed amid violent protests in Nepal
Nepal Protests: The Kathmandu Airport is reopening on Wednesday, a day after violent protests in Nepal forced it to shut down, Nepal's Civil Aviation Authority has said. The decision was made after the authorities held a meeting on Wednesday as the Nepal Army imposed nationwide restrictions to curb violence.

As per a report by NDTV, Rajyalaxmi Chitrakar, the wife of Nepal's ex-prime minister Jhalanath Khanal, was burnt alive on Tuesday. She was trapped in her house, located in Dallu area in the state capital Kathmandu, which Gen Z protestors had set on fire. Chitrakar was rushed to Kirtipur Burn Hospital but died during the treatment, NDTV reported.
